Buying Guide

When choosing a sit‑and‑cycle bike, consider where you will use it, how much space you have, and who will use it. A quiet, low‑profile model is ideal for apartments and offices. Resistance range matters for progression, especially for seniors or rehab, so magnetic resistance with multiple levels is advantageous. Look for durable construction, a comfortable seat or compact footprint, and a stable base with non‑slip pedals. Some models include apps or tracking features that help you monitor progress over weeks and months. Accessories such as floor mats and resistance bands add value and variety to routines.

  • Space and footprint: Choose under‑desk or compact freestanding designs that fit your workspace.
  • Resistance options: Magnetic resistance with 8–16 levels offers scalable workouts for varying fitness levels.
  • Comfort and safety: Adjustable straps, stable pedals, and ergonomic seating support longer sessions.
  • Noise and smoothness: Look for near‑silent operation for shared spaces and work environments.
  • Connectivity and tracking: LCD displays provide real‑time metrics; apps can add guided plans and progress updates.
  • Durability and warranty: A solid frame and reasonable warranty protect your investment over time.
